Output 3032f7627ef919c5310f007a1476a9f711e001a1a20f92f68ee38ae84d9080e1:0

value
3282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e7f93189f9e2a76e536387c903b0a0bf5073951 OP_EQUAL
address
3DDstkc2UaA5fwfCXiew5FVaGkZfHm5qSs
transaction
3032f7627ef919c5310f007a1476a9f711e001a1a20f92f68ee38ae84d9080e1
spent
true